Coysevox, Antoine (1640-1720)
Fame riding on Pegasus (back, after restoration). 1698-1702. Provenance: Bassin de l'Abreuvoir (upper balustrade), Parc de Marly. Carrara marble, 315 x 291 x 128 cm. Acquired in 1986. MR1824. Photo: René-Gabriel Ojeda. 
Location Musée du Louvre/Paris/France
